Q: How does the recovery time feature work?
A: After each workout, the built-in recovery time feature will let you know how long to rest before another big effort.
Q: What is the battery life of this smartwatch?
A: The battery lasts for up to 2 weeks in smartwatch mode and up to 20 hours in GPS mode.
Q: What is the minimum and maximum wrist size for this smartwatch?
A: The minimum wrist size is 126 millimeters and the maximum wrist size is 203 millimeters.
Q: Does this smartwatch have built-in GPS?
A: Yes, the Forerunner 55 has built-in GPS to track your runs and provide accurate stats.
Q: What is the screen resolution of this smartwatch?
A: The screen resolution is 208 x 208.
Q: Does this smartwatch track heart rate?
A: Yes, the Forerunner 55 tracks your heart rate and will send alerts if it stays high while you are at rest.
Q: Can I download additional apps for this smartwatch?
A: Yes, you can download custom watch faces, add data fields, and get apps from the Connect IQ Store.

I’ve been using the Garmin Forerunner 55 GPS Smartwatch for a while now, and it has proven to be an excellent tool for tracking my fitness journey. The GPS accuracy is impressive, and the race time predictor feature is a great motivator for improving my performance. I also appreciate the daily suggested workouts, which help me stay consistent and challenge myself. The watch is lightweight and comfortable to wear, even during long runs. The battery life is decent, lasting several days with regular use. However, the display resolution could be better—it feels a bit outdated compared to other smartwatches in the same price range. Overall, the Garmin Forerunner 55 is a solid choice for runners and fitness enthusiasts looking for a reliable and user-friendly smartwatch.
